the color is great, but the clarity leaves something to be desired. I got a hook up on my gf's gift. I got her 14KW diamond studs. They are F color and a VS2 Clarity, round brilliant cut, 4 prong screw backs. Got it for $345 shipped w/ a certification. That SI isnt the best. Work out the details for the pendent first, then the chain. You can get a chain anywhere. Let us know how it goes.

You can bargain as long as you know what you are talking about. If you can talk about all those visable inclusions, you should be able to do something. Just stay on topic with the stone and not the chain. Who cares about the size of the stone if it has all those inclusions. You may get some of the better color, but the inclusions (SI) is way too much IMO.
